The downloads pages contain descriptions of FREE Add-Ins for use with Microsoft Access.  There are only two files to download.  One file, dbswiz.exe, is the Access 97 version and the second file, dbswiz2k.exe, is the Access 2000 version.  Each file contains all of the Add-Ins described below.  The Setup routine itself will allow you to choose which of the add-ins to install.

What's the catch?  There is no catch.  You can use it freely and distribute it freely to other Access users.  There is, however, one condition.  We ask that all copyrights in the add-in be kept intact.  Also, any copyright created by the add-in when inserted into your code be kept intact.  The only thing we want in return is credit for our work.  And as courtesy, if you download the add-ins and find them helpful, would you e-mail us and tell us as much.  We will keep your e-mail in our database and when upgrades and improvements become available, we will notify you. 

There is also one very important caveat.  These add-in are free and you are getting what you pay for.  As of now the help files are extremely limited. This may be improving soon.  Support is NOT included with the download.  (We will do phone support at a rate of $75.00/hour.  If you are interested in this please e-mail us.)  Although we have been using most of these add-ins for several years and attest to their reliability, we have NOT tested them in every possible target environment.  Use these add-ins at your own risk.
